  +divstyle.js+ adds a user-extensible style mechanism, that parallels
  CSS styles but can contain properties that are not in the CSS
  standard.
  
  When +divstyle.js+ is loaded, <tt><div></tt> tags in the HTML
  document that have a class of "+style+" can contain (a subset of)
  CSS, but with nonstandard property names.  Each element that is
  selected by a "div CSS" rule has a +.divStyle+ property.  The value
  of this property is a map of property names to values.

  == Usage
    <html>
      <head>
        <-- include the divstyle implementation: -->
        <script type="text/javascript" src="behaviour.js"></script>
        <script type="text/javascript" src="divstyle.js"></script>
      </head>
      <body>
        <!-- define the styles: -->
        <div class="style">
          #e1, .myclass {my-property: 'string', prop1: 123}
          .myclass {prop2: #ff0000}
        </div>
        
        <!-- define the elements.  The styles are applied to these. -->
        <div id="e1"></div>
        <div id="e2" class="myclass"></div>
        <div id="e3" class="myclass"></div>
        
        <!-- access the styles from JavaScript: -->
        <script type="text/javascript">
          alert(document.getElementById('e1').divStyle.myProperty);
          alert(document.getElementById('e2').divStyle.prop1);
          alert(document.getElementById('e3').divStyle.prop2);
          var rules = document.divStylesheet.cssRules; // all the rules
        </script>
       </body>
     </html>
  
  == Caveats
  You can't put the style content in comments. (Safari strips comments
  from the DOM before JavaScript sees them.)
  
  CSS simple selectors are limited to at most one modifier
  (+div.c1+, but not +div.c1.c2+).
  
  Quotes inside an attribute name selector may not work.
  
  The CSS parser is incomplete, and doesn't recover from many parse
  errors.
